About: Watch New York Yankees, Brooklyn Nets, New York City Football Club, and New York
Liberty games live on the YES Network app. In addition to watching YES
Network’s broadcasts of live games, you will also be able to stream all of
YES’ additional programming, including Yankees and Nets Pre and Post-Game
Shows, Yankees Magazine, The Michael Kay Show, and much more.
